The Tapas-Inspired Dressing Secret

On his popular show, James Martin's Saturday Morning, the 53-year-old chef demonstrated his go-to method for cooking leeks, which are in their prime between November and March. After washing and charring them on a grill or barbecue for maximum impact, he tops them with crispy lardons and a signature dressing.

The real game-changer in his recipe, however, is an unexpected addition. "When I was in the tapas place, I couldn't think what it was, and when I went into the back of the kitchen it was oyster sauce," Martin explained. He enthused that just a tiny bit of oyster sauce provides an incredible aroma and takes the leeks to "another level."

His versatile dressing combines chopped hazelnuts, bacon fat, hazelnut oil,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, sherry vinegar, fresh parsley, and the crucial dash of oyster sauce.

A Zero-Waste Winter Staple

Demonstrating a commitment to avoiding food waste, Martin also showed viewers how to use every part of the vegetable. He repurposed the often-discarded leafy green tops into a comforting leek and potato soup, prepared in "less than five minutes."

For a clever garnish, he thinly sliced and gently deep-fried the green ends until crisp. "You don't waste any of it because you've got all this amazing flavour from it," he stated. The simple soup involves softening leeks in milk and butter, adding grated potato and seasoning, then blending until smooth.
